2021 Volvo XC90 Recharge Plug-In Hybrid
Volvo’s long-running midsize SUV, the XC90, keeps things eco-friendly with the Recharge plug-in hybrid (PHEV) option—without losing any of the classiness you’d expect from Volvo along the way.
In 2015, Volvo
introduced the world’s first seven-passenger plug-in hybrid SUV: the XC90 Recharge, also called the T8. The 2021 version is packed with a higher battery capacity and a whole lot of refinement, making it a solid option for a luxury hybrid SUV. Pricing
A shiny new 2021 Recharge PHEV had an MSRP of $63,450—but since it’s already been out for a bit, you may be able to find a used one for less. Compared to the gas-powered XC90 base model, the Recharge PHEV was a whopping $14,450 more expensive brand new.
However, when you factor in the potential $5,419 federal tax credit you’ll get with the 2021 Volvo XC90 Recharge Plug-In Hybrid, it’s only around $9,000 more. Note that buyers are only eligible for PHEV tax credits when purchasing a brand new model though.
Performance and fuel economy
The XC90 Recharge Plug-In Hybrid is equipped with a turbocharged four-cylinder engine, cranking out 400 horsepower, as well as an eight-speed automatic transmission and all-wheel drive. You may be skeptical of an SUV with four cylinders rather than six, but with an electric motor, the XC90 PHEV is still a thrill to drive.
What makes the XC90 Recharge better than a regular SUV, though, is the fuel economy. While a gas-powered XC90 gets a meager 22 combined mpg, the XC90 Recharge earns 27 combined mpg with gas alone—and a sweet 55 MPGe when gas and electricity work together.
A bonus of PHEVs over standard hybrids is that they can run on electricity alone some of the time. With the electric battery, the 2021 XC90 Recharge can go 18 miles. This doesn’t sound like much, but it’s the perfect distance if you have a short commute or are running nearby errands. However, this is one of the shortest electric-only ranges in its class by 2 miles.
The electric-only mode won’t get you very far without a full charge, though. Thankfully, the 2021 XC90 Recharge takes just three hours of charging with a Level 2 (240V) charger to reach 100%. If you only have access to a Level 1 (120V), you’ll need to set aside eight to nine hours for your Recharge to… well, recharge.
While the 2021 XC90 Recharge is a seamless drive, it won’t blow your mind when it comes to quick acceleration. That being said, it’s plenty powerful to be reliable on the road for any type of driving you’ll be doing.
Exterior styling
The XC90 Recharge has a quintessentially Volvo design, with simple, clean lines that maintain the brand’s minimal-yet-elegant style. Volvo makes no effort to distinguish the hybrid from the gas-powered XC90—a bonus if you like to keep your love of Mother Nature more low-key.
The Recharge’s simplicity also extends to the color options. While there are seven to choose from, they’re all extremely subdued, ranging from Ice White and Onyx Black Metallic to Thunder Grey Metallic and Bright Silver Metallic. If you’re looking for something bold, Denim Blue Metallic is your only option.
Interior and comfort
When it comes to higher-end vehicles, you can always count on a luxury interior, too—and the XC90 Recharge follows through. The front seats in particular are so comfy you may not want to get out of your car.
The second row—whether fit with captain’s chairs or a three-seat bench—is equally as cushy, though it doesn’t have as much legroom as some competing models.
The XC90 makes up for it, however, with best-in-class third-row legroom. It’s not a minivan-level amount of space, but it’s spacious enough for kids to sit comfortably—or adults, if it’s a relatively short drive.
As a seven-seater, the XC90 Recharge only has 11.2 cubic feet of cargo space to work with—standard for midsize SUVs. Pop the back seats down, and you’ll enjoy 64.1 cubic feet of cargo space.

Warranty coverage
Another place where Volvo keeps it simple is their warranty coverage, which is pretty average. However, they offer complimentary maintenance for three years or 36,000 miles, putting them a step above the competition.
Here’s how the warranty works for the 2021 XC90 Recharge Plug-In Hybrid:
Limited warranty: 4 years or 50,000 miles
Powertrain warranty: 4 years or 50,000 miles
Battery warranty: 8 years or 100,000 miles
Trim levels and options
The 2021 Volvo XC90 Recharge comes in two different trim options: the sport-focused R-Design or the more luxe Inscription trim. Both are considered topline for the XC90, so they’re set with elegant features like leather upholstery, ventilated front seats with massage functions, a digital gauge cluster, and a Harman/Kardon audio system.
If these aren’t enough for you, you also have the choice to add five different packages to your XC90 Recharge, from the Climate Package to the Protection Package Premier.
